How to Prepare Your Law Firm for Microsoft Copilot and AI Tools

How to Prepare Your Law Firm for Microsoft Copilot and AI Tools

AI tools like Microsoft Copilot promise real gains for law firms.

Faster document drafting, smarter research, streamlined communication, and less time on administrative work.

But here is what the firms that see genuine results have in common: they prepared before they deployed.

Preparing your law firm for Microsoft Copilot starts with the fundamentals. AI works by finding and organizing information that already exists in your systems. If that information is scattered, inconsistently organized, or stored across disconnected platforms, the AI will struggle; and so will your team.

The good news is that preparation is straightforward when you break it down into clear steps.

The Foundation Your Firm Needs Before AI Delivers Value

Organize your data. Files, emails, client records, and case documents should live in structured, accessible locations. If people cannot find what they need without searching everywhere, AI will not fix that; it will expose it.

Audit your systems. Identify which tools your firm uses, which ones connect smoothly, and where manual workarounds still exist. AI works best on clean, connected infrastructure.

Set clear access controls. Copilot accesses the data your team can access. Before deployment, review permissions and make sure sensitive client information is protected appropriately.

Train your people. Technology without adoption creates cost, not value. Brief, practical training helps staff use AI tools consistently and confidently.
